History and Heritage of the Inglehoffer Brand
Originally launched in 1901 by a mustard miller in Pennsylvania, the Inglehoffer Brand grew from a small family operation into a nationally recognized condiment powerhouse. Decades of recipe refinement turned humble mustard seeds into a lineup of award-winning spreads. Over time, the brand expanded its portfolio, introducing mustards with honey, dill, and even horseradish. What began as a regional favorite is now a staple in pantries across the United States and beyond.
Key milestones include:
- 1901: First jars of Inglehoffer Mustard hit local markets in Lancaster County, PA.
- 1950s: Launch of Inglehoffer Mustard Honey varieties to meet growing demand for sweeter condiments.
- 1980s: Expansion into gourmet lines, featuring Inglehoffer Dijon Mustard and Inglehoffer dijon stone ground mustard.
- 2000s: Integration of modern packaging and online sales through the Inglehoffer website.

Pairing and Serving Suggestions
Sure, slathering any mustard on a sandwich is a no-brainer. But why stop there? Amp up your culinary game with these creative serving ideas:
- Glazed Meats: Combine Inglehoffer mustard honey with brown sugar and a splash of cider for an irresistible pork loin glaze.
- Dipping Sauces: Mix Inglehoffer sweet hot mustard with honey into mayonnaise for a zesty aioli that shines alongside fries or crudités.
- Salad Dressings: Whisk Inglehoffer Dijon Mustard with olive oil, lemon juice, and garlic to enliven green salads and grain bowls.
- Sandwich Spreads: Layer Creamy dill mustard under smoked salmon on a bagel for an upscale take on brunch.
- Marinades: Stir Inglehoffer horseradish into yogurt and herbs for a steak marinade that packs a punch.

FAQs
Is Inglehoffer mustard German mustard?
Despite its German-sounding name, Inglehoffer mustard is an American-made product, founded in Pennsylvania. While it draws inspiration from traditional German methods—like stone grinding and robust spice blends—the recipes have a distinctly American twist.
